Current crowd conditions?
Can anyone who has been at WDW in the last 2 weeks or so give a report on how the crowd levels have been?
I've never been in September before...expecting heat and humidity, but not sure about crowds. I'm hoping that since (a) vacation season is over and school is in full swing, and (b) we'll be there M-W, the levels may be fairly low. Re: Current crowd conditions?
We came home last night, and I thought the crowds were great. As was said, everything was a minimal wait or walk on. Some of the big ones had a 20 minute wait (RnR, Peter Pan, Dumbo), but nothing major. The only big one was TSM, which was a 180 minute wait mid day, and was completely out of FP by late afternoon. My suggestion is to run to TSM first thing at the studios, and when you come out, FP for later in the day! It is definately worth 2 rides, but I would never wait 2-3 hours for one ride!
The weather was a bit muggy, and normally hot, but totally manageable. Count on an early evening rain, an keep your poncho/umbrella handy. We never had more than and hour or so of rain on any day. The temps and humidity were up in the low to mid 90's every day!

Re: Current crowd conditions?
We got back on Sunday from 2 weeks...crowds were light at all times except EMH evening hours and the water parks on the weekends...Sat. at least was PACKED, like no seats available....it was HOT, though, and most were foreigners and local FL folk.
I would skip EMH....really. Oh, and I noticed that the preschooler rides were actually crowded, and the lines long for the pooh characters and such...I call September PreSchool Peak Season....the line for Dumbo on Sept. 13 was at least 30 mins, but you could walk on Space Mountain. Go figure! The Halloween party was also crowded in toontown only...the rest of the park was deserted! have a great trip!!
